With Community or Chameleon, the user has the ability to login using Sign in with Google
Enable Google Login
You need to:
- Turn on the Google Login feature
- Assign a Google Client ID (if not already assigned)
To enable Google Login in your instance of Chameleon, go to Configuration > Preferences > search Google > select "Google > Login" > change the value to TRUE > Update Now.

Add a User with a Google Login
- In User control, Add User
- Add user info.
- Use a GMAIL email address
- And be sure to select Google as your Login Method
- Add New User Now
Editing Existing Users
- You can modify an existing user to access via Google Login by changing their current email address to a Gmail email address.
- When a user first logs into Chameleon or Community using Google Logins, they will be asked to Authorize the account.
- If a user tries to login with Google but their Gmail account wasn't assigned with their Chameleon user account, access will be denied.
